Away v East Retford 2s

Pennant

Won 17-29

Trys: Briggs-Price, Codd, Dixon, Tinsley, Holmes.

Cons: Lee 2

After losing by only a few points at home to East Retford earlier in the season we knew if we went to them with a fairly strong side we could redress the balance. That said lack of backs was going to be a problem with the late loss of our full back and only one centre available. As has become the norm this season we filled in the gaps with willing volunteers/pressed men and got on with it.

We got off to a good start with an early try from Zac Briggs-Price. the second row playing in the centres forced his way over after tireless work from the forwards. No extra points from the boot of 10 for the day and skipper Tom Lee but it was a tight angle. It was the forwards who struck next with a lineout catch and drive. Trigger took the ball from the ever straight arm of Dick White and off we trundled towards the line. It was new boy Grant Dixon having best game for us so far who got the touch down for an 8 man try. Again no extras from an even tighter angle but our opponents didn't quite know what had hit them.

We'd come out of the blocks like whats-his-name Bolt and we weren't done as we scored straight from the next restart. Young Josh Codd started and finished a move as the back row took the high ball and set off weaving in and out of the oncoming forwards. He was tackled by the winger but had some back up and the ball was recycled several times before he got the ball again to jink through to score in the corner. Great play by the former colt who had another great game.

After conceding a try by East Retfords big pack it was returning player Joe Tinsley who scored next for us. The former prop was playing in the centres and after some initial handling problems made a great impact on the game. His tackling was good and always made yards with ball in hand (once he’d caught it). His try was quite simple but more importantly it was under the posts so no mistake from the skippers boot. A good job really as East Retford scored another try with more of less the last move of the half.

We lead 10-22 at half time and a relaxed half time talk pointed out that our discipline had put us ahead as our opponents had been getting the refs back up while we'd just got on with the task. It was an untidy game but that was working for us for once. We were getting the rub of the green for a change.

The early part of the second half was a tight affair with both side feeding on the other teams mistakes. Having had one yellow card in the first half our hosts managed to get two more in the second half which was lucky for them as one should have been a red for a sliding tackle. Would have been a red in football. Down to 13 players they kicked for clearance but it went straight down full back Callum Holmes throat. He ran from deep in our half, slipping tackles and wrong footing defenders all the way the score under the posts. Fantastic try and more than deserved from the hard working young lad.

East Retford had the last word point wise but we'd done our talking by coming to a hostile place and keeping our heads, playing the rugby and making the best of an uneven pitch. Our level headedness and total team work paid dividends.

Names of note include Ben Pindar having a good game coming on at hooker and Dick White playing till the end and possibly being late for work. Sorry mate. Josh Duggan had a great game making yards every time he picked up the ball and another new lad Lee Dentith coming on at no8 making big hits. Rob Garland had another good showing and scrum half Gaz Morgan had a great game and was in everything. That being said it was the team performance in general that was so pleasing. Everyone played for eachother and put a real shift in until the final whistle.
